Gravel biking around Harrislee features routes that navigate the border region between Germany and Denmark, offering views of the Flensburg Fjord. The terrain primarily consists of coastal paths and areas around the fjord, with some routes including moderate elevation gains. The landscape is characterized by open views, rolling hills, and proximity to water bodies, providing varied surfaces suitable for gravel cycling.

Best gravel bike trails around Harrislee

  • The most popular gravel bike trail is Schusterkate Border Crossing (Germany–Denmark) – View of Flensburg loop from Flensburg / Flensborg, a 28.5 miles (45.9 km) trail that takes 3 hours 25 minutes to complete. This moderate route offers views of Flensburg and crosses the border.
  • Another top favourite among local gravel bikers is Flensburg Fjord – Flensburg Harbor loop from Flensburg, a moderate 26.5 miles (42.7 km) path. This route leads through the Flensburg Fjord and harbor areas.
  • Local gravel bikers also love the Schusterkate Border Crossing (Germany–Denmark) – View of Flensburg Fjord loop from Flensburg / Flensborg, a 53.9 miles (86.7 km) trail leading through the Flensburg Fjord and the German-Danish border region, often completed in about 4 hours 58 minutes.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many gravel bike trails are there around Harrislee?

There are over 60 gravel bike trails available around Harrislee, offering a wide range of options for different skill levels and preferences. The region's network includes routes navigating the border area between Germany and Denmark, often with views of the Flensburg Fjord.

Are there easy gravel bike trails suitable for beginners in Harrislee?

Yes, Harrislee offers several easy gravel bike trails perfect for beginners. Out of the 65 routes, 17 are classified as easy, providing a gentle introduction to gravel biking in the region. These routes typically feature less challenging terrain and elevation changes.

Are there challenging gravel bike routes for experienced riders?

For experienced riders seeking a challenge, Harrislee has 7 difficult gravel bike routes. One such route is the Schusterkate Border Crossing (Germany–Denmark) – View of Flensburg Fjord loop from Flensburg / Flensborg, which covers 86.7 km with significant elevation gain, offering a demanding ride through varied landscapes.

Are there any circular gravel bike routes in the Harrislee area?

Many of the gravel bike routes around Harrislee are designed as loops, allowing you to start and end at the same point. For example, the popular Flensburg Fjord Marina – Glücksburg Fjord Promenade loop from Flensburg / Flensborg is a moderate 57.7 km circular path that follows the fjord.

What kind of terrain can I expect on gravel bike trails in Harrislee?

Gravel biking around Harrislee is characterized by diverse terrain. You'll primarily encounter coastal paths and routes around the Flensburg Fjord, often with open views. Some routes include moderate elevation gains, and the surfaces are varied, making them suitable for gravel cycling.

What natural attractions can I explore along the gravel bike trails near Harrislee?

The region around Harrislee offers several natural attractions accessible from gravel bike routes. You can discover beautiful lakes like the Western shore of Lake Roikier, Sankelmarker Lake, and Niehuussee. Additionally, you might encounter the King's Oak at Glücksburg Castle or the Twedter Feld Nature Reserve.

Are there any bike parks or specific MTB trails near Harrislee?

Yes, for those looking for dedicated mountain biking experiences, there are bike parks and specific MTB trails nearby. Highlights include the MTB Trail – Kelstrup Plantation and the Höckeberg Singletrack, which offer more technical riding options.

When is the best time of year for gravel biking around Harrislee?

The coastal and fjord-side nature of Harrislee's gravel trails makes spring, summer, and early autumn ideal. During these seasons, you'll generally experience milder weather and longer daylight hours, perfect for enjoying the open views and varied terrain. Always check local weather forecasts before heading out.

Is gravel biking possible in Harrislee during winter?

Gravel biking in Harrislee during winter is possible, though conditions can be more challenging. The coastal proximity means temperatures might be milder than inland, but you should be prepared for colder weather, potential rain, and possibly icy or muddy sections on trails. Ensure your bike is equipped for winter conditions and dress appropriately.

What do other gravel bikers enjoy most about gravel biking in Harrislee?

The komoot community highly rates gravel biking in Harrislee, with an average score of 4.4 stars from over 100 reviews. Riders often praise the diverse terrain, the scenic views of the Flensburg Fjord, and the unique experience of navigating the border region between Germany and Denmark.

Are there gravel bike routes accessible by public transport?

Many routes around Harrislee start from locations easily reachable by public transport, particularly those originating from Flensburg. For instance, the Schusterkate Border Crossing (Germany–Denmark) – View of Flensburg loop from Altstadt is a moderate 21.4 km route that begins from Flensburg's Old Town, which is well-connected.

Where can I find parking for gravel biking in Harrislee?

Parking is generally available at common starting points for many routes, especially in and around Flensburg, which serves as a hub for many Harrislee-area trails. Look for designated parking areas near the start of routes, particularly those that are loops or originate from urban centers.
